
Salcatonin Nasal Spray: A Breakthrough Treatment for Osteoporosis and Bone Health

Salcatonin Nasal Spray, a synthetic formulation of salmon calcitonin, is gaining recognition as a non-invasive and effective treatment for osteoporosis and other bone-related disorders.
As a hormone naturally produced by the thyroid gland, calcitonin plays a vital role in regulating calcium levels in the blood and promoting bone health.
Salcatonin, derived from salmon, is biologically similar to human calcitonin but is much more potent.
Delivered through a nasal spray, it offers patients an alternative to traditional injectable forms of treatment, improving compliance and convenience for individuals dealing with bone diseases.
What is Salcatonin Nasal Spray?
Salcatonin Nasal Spray is a medication used primarily to treat osteoporosis in postmenopausal women and men at risk of fractures.
Osteoporosis is a condition characterized by weakened bones, making them more susceptible to fractures.
The nasal spray formulation allows the active ingredient, salmon calcitonin, to be absorbed through the nasal mucosa, making it easier for patients who are uncomfortable with injections or oral medications to maintain their treatment regimen.
Salmon calcitonin works by inhibiting the activity of osteoclasts, the cells responsible for breaking down bone tissue.
By reducing the rate of bone resorption, Salcatonin helps preserve bone density and strength, reducing the risk of fractures, especially in patients with osteoporosis.
Salcatonin Mechanism of Action
Salcatonin, both human and salmon-derived, regulates bone metabolism by interacting with receptors on osteoclasts, the cells that break down bone tissue.
In osteoporosis, there is an imbalance between bone resorption and bone formation, leading to a loss of bone density.
Salcatonin helps restore this balance by:
- Inhibiting Osteoclast Activity: By binding to receptors on osteoclasts, Salcatonin suppresses their activity, preventing excessive bone breakdown.
- Reducing Bone Turnover: It lowers the rate at which bone is resorbed and replaced, leading to a more stable bone structure.
- Increasing Bone Density: Over time, the reduction in bone resorption can help increase or stabilize bone density, making bones less fragile.
This combination of actions makes Salcatonin Nasal Spray an effective therapy for osteoporosis, especially in individuals who have already suffered fractures or those at high risk for fractures due to decreased bone mass.
Clinical Applications
Salcatonin Nasal Spray is most commonly prescribed for:
- Osteoporosis in Postmenopausal Women: After menopause, women experience a sharp decline in estrogen levels, which accelerates bone loss. Salcatonin helps manage this process by slowing bone resorption and improving bone density.
- Osteoporosis in Men: While osteoporosis is more common in women, men also suffer from bone density loss as they age, particularly those with other risk factors like low testosterone levels. Salcatonin has shown effectiveness in treating male osteoporosis.
- Paget’s Disease of Bone: This condition causes abnormal bone remodeling, leading to weakened and deformed bones. Salcatonin can help regulate bone resorption in patients with Paget’s disease.
- Fracture Prevention: For patients with a history of fractures due to weakened bones, Salcatonin Nasal Spray is often used to help prevent future breaks.

Safety and Side Effects Of Salcatonin Nasal
Salcatonin Nasal Spray is generally well-tolerated, but like all medications, it can cause side effects. The most common side effects include:
- Nasal Irritation: Some patients may experience nasal congestion, irritation, or a runny nose as a result of the spray.
- Headache: A mild headache can occur, particularly during the initial stages of treatment.
- Flushing or Warmth: Some patients may feel flushed or warm in the face or upper body after using the nasal spray.
- Allergic Reactions: Though rare, allergic reactions such as rash, itching, or swelling of the face may occur. If any signs of an allergic reaction are noted, patients should seek medical attention immediately.
Long-term use of Salcatonin Nasal Spray has been generally safe, but as with any medication, it should be used under the supervision of a healthcare provider.
Patients with a history of nasal problems, such as chronic rhinitis or sinusitis, should consult their doctor before starting treatment.
Considerations and Alternatives
While Salcatonin Nasal Spray is effective in managing osteoporosis and other bone conditions, it may not be suitable for all patients.
For those with severe nasal issues or those who cannot tolerate nasal delivery, alternative treatment options are available, including:
- Oral Bisphosphonates: These are commonly prescribed to help prevent bone loss, though they may carry a higher risk of gastrointestinal side effects.
- Subcutaneous Injections of Denosumab: A biologic medication that can help strengthen bones in osteoporosis patients by inhibiting bone resorption.
- Teriparatide: A synthetic form of parathyroid hormone that stimulates bone formation and can be used in more severe cases of osteoporosis.
Patients should work closely with their healthcare provider to determine the best treatment option based on their specific health needs, preferences, and medical history.
